One of the most iconic Korean haircuts is the see-through bangs. This style features thin, wispy bangs that frame the face without overwhelming it, offering a soft and airy look. See-through bangs work well with both long and short hair, adding a youthful and playful touch. The two-block haircut is another popular choice, especially among men. This style involves a clear distinction between the top and sides of the hair, with the top left longer and the sides cropped short. It’s a versatile cut that can be styled in numerous ways, from sleek and polished to tousled and casual. For women seeking a more dramatic change, the hush cut offers an edgy yet feminine option. This haircut features layers that create volume and movement, with the ends slightly flipped out for a playful effect. The C-curl perm is a beloved Korean hairstyle that adds subtle curls to the ends of the hair, creating a soft and natural look. This style is ideal for those who want to add volume and bounce to their hair without going for full curls. The wolf cut has recently gained popularity, offering a bold and adventurous option for those looking to make a statement. This haircut combines elements of the mullet and shag, with shorter layers on top and longer sections at the back.
